When where timepieces or clocks first made? The wristwatches we have today were patterned from spring-driven clocks, which initially existed on the 15th century. Spring driven clocks were also made as portable devices. Its handiness became possible because of the development of the mainspring that serves as its power source. The first worn watches were made during the 16th century. During this time, clock-watches were clipped to clothes or displayed through a chain on the neck. Timepieces were then as big as a shoebox and were carved with intricate designs. In the olden times, these timepieces only had an hour hand and faces grilled with brass instead of a glass fixture like what clocks or wristwatches have today. As time went by, the pocket watch came into style. Men transitioned from wearing timepieces on their necks to putting it on their pockets while women still wore it as pendants until the 20th century.
From the ancient sundials and hourglasses, watches came through as the product of timepiece evolution. In the 1920's wristwatches were born. On this era, only women wore them because wristwatches were dubbed as an unmanly accessory. When soldiers started using them during the war, they were now considered fashionable. This timepiece worn by soldiers was then called trench watch. In the 1950's electric timepieces came into view. After this innovation, quartz watch revolutionized the world of time keeping technology.
